Transaction e5dc3f7987efa21a10856d0fc342ed2641d256c7947afec178a366cbb100fc9c
1 Input
1 Output
-
e5dc3f7987efa21a10856d0fc342ed2641d256c7947afec178a366cbb100fc9c:0
- value
- 512762
- script pubkey
- OP_0 OP_PUSHBYTES_20 1a3e2c763c2ea16e43545fd6ac9e4b66a319b45a
- address
- bc1qrglzca3u96skus65tlt2e8jtv633ndz68tjkp3